OLUDOTUN ADEBOLA ADEFOPE-OKOJIE, J.C.A. (Delivering the Lead Ruling): The Motion of the Applicants, dated and filed on 13/5/15, seeks the following reliefs:

1. An order granting the Appellants/Applicants extension of time within which to appeal against the Ruling of the Kano State High Court (Coram: Honourable Justice Shehu Atiku) delivered on 7th March, 2005.

2. An order of this Honourable Court substituting MAINSTREET BANK LIMITED for the 4th Respondent in this appeal, the said 4th Respondent having been acquired by the Defunct AFRIBANK PLC (now Mainstreet Bank Limited) sometimes in 2006.

3. An order deeming the Appellants/Applicants' Notice of Appeal already filed and served as having been properly filed and served, the prescribed fees having been paid.

4. An order directing that the appeal be heard on the basis of the Record of Appeal already compiled and transmitted to this Honourable Court by the lower Court on 5th October, 2006.
